Bear Log – Travel Date, Saturday, April 8, 2006

Day 2 of the big convention.  Most of today I was in the booth, listening to all kinds of people talk about bears and other animals.  Bear makers talked about fur types and how to dye things and doing noses and eyes and ears.

Today there was a front page article in the local newspaper here about the Convention.  There were pictures of bears and lots of information about the history of the teddy bear and of the convention.

During the show, the people who came to visit got to vote on the Best in Show bears by putting the number of their favorite bear in the ballot box. 

After the show closed today, there was a vendor reception.  There was cheese and crackers and shrimp and brownies….very yummy!

scott3.jpgshellie3.jpg

During the reception the results of the Best of Show voting were announced.  The winners this year were:  3rd place, a tie between Donna Butts and Connie Alexander; 2nd place, Scott MacKenzie and 1st place, Kimberly Welton.
